Visit the Patrick Kavanagh Centre
Explore the rich literary heritage of Monaghan by visiting the Patrick Kavanagh Centre in Inniskeen. This museum is dedicated to the life and work of one of Ireland’s greatest poets, offering an immersive experience into his world. In October, Monaghan’s weather can be chilly and damp, making it a perfect time to enjoy indoor attractions. The centre often hosts educational events and readings, providing a warm, intellectual retreat. It’s one of the best things to do in Monaghan Ireland in October to appreciate local culture.
Take a Walk in Rossmore Forest Park
If you’re blessed with one of the crisp, sunny days in October, a walk in Rossmore Forest Park is highly recommended. The park boasts beautiful trails, lakes, and intriguing sculptures scattered throughout. As the autumn leaves turn, the park becomes a picturesque setting, ideal for a leisurely stroll or a more vigorous hike. Make sure to wear layers, as the weather can change quickly. Enjoy a Performance at the Garage Theatre
The Garage Theatre in Monaghan town offers a variety of performances including drama, comedy, and music events. October’s unpredictable weather makes visiting the theatre a comfortable indoor option. Keep an eye on the theatre’s calendar for local and national productions that showcase emerging and established talent. It’s a great way to spend an evening appreciating the arts scene in Monaghan. Explore Monaghan County Museum
The Monaghan County Museum offers fascinating displays on the region’s history from prehistoric times to the present day. In October, when outdoor activities might be less appealing due to potential rain, this museum provides an excellent indoor educational experience. With a range of interactive exhibits, it’s suitable for all ages and an essential visit for history enthusiasts.
